Reviewer's Guide

Updates the linux2rest bootstrap script to pull version v0.9.4 of the linux2rest tool instead of v0.9.3.

File-Level Changes

Change Details Files
Bump linux2rest tool version from v0.9.3 to v0.9.4 in the bootstrap script.
  • Update the VERSION variable to reference v0.9.4
  • Keep repository organization, name, and project name unchanged while pointing to the new release tag
core/tools/linux2rest/bootstrap.sh

Assessment against linked issues

Issue Objective Addressed Explanation
#3764 Fix the System Information/Processes CPU usage percentage so that reported values are accurate and meaningful (including on initial page load and during normal operation), allowing reliable performance monitoring between sessions.
